WAKS

WAKS (96.5 FM) is a commercial radio station licensed to Akron, Ohio, United States, featuring a contemporary hit radio format as "96.5 Kiss FM". Owned by iHeartMedia, WAKS serves Greater Cleveland, Northeast Ohio and the Akron metropolitan area. Although licensed to Akron, the station is assigned by Nielsen to the Cleveland radio market.
